Message type: E = Error
Message class: 0D - FS-CD General Messages
Message number: 144
Message text: Enter a valid start date and a valid start time

- Enter a valid start date and a valid start time ?The SAP error message 0D144 ("Enter a valid start date and a valid start time") typically occurs when a user is trying to enter a date and time in a transaction or program, but the values provided are either invalid or not in the expected format. This error can arise in various contexts, such as scheduling jobs, creating events, or entering data in specific fields.
Causes:
- Invalid Date Format: The date entered may not conform to the expected format (e.g., MM/DD/YYYY, DD/MM/YYYY).
- Invalid Time Format: The time entered may not be in the correct format (e.g., HH:MM in 24-hour format).
- Out of Range Dates: The date entered may be outside the acceptable range (e.g., a date in the past when only future dates are allowed).
- Missing Fields: Either the date or time field may be left blank, leading to the error.
- System Settings: User profile settings or system parameters may restrict the acceptable date and time formats.
Solutions:
- Check Date and Time Format: Ensure that the date and time are entered in the correct format as specified by the system. Refer to the documentation or help text for the expected format.
- Validate Date and Time Values: Make sure that the date and time values are valid (e.g., not a weekend or holiday if the system restricts those).
- Fill in Missing Fields: Ensure that both the start date and start time fields are filled in.
- Use Date Picker: If available, use the date picker tool to select the date, which can help avoid format issues.
- Check User Settings: Review your user profile settings to ensure that they are configured correctly for date and time formats.
- Consult Documentation: If the error persists, consult the SAP documentation or help resources for specific guidance related to the transaction or module you are working with.
